- [ ] **Step 7: Breaker override escrow.** After sealing the signing keys for the Tallgrove upstream API circuit breaker, confirm the support team can force the breaker open during a full outage. The override bundle lives in the sealed escrow drawer and is useless without its unlock phrase. Two ceremony witnesses must initial this step before proceeding. The escrow bundle is decrypted with the recovery passphrase that follows.

vault phrase of kahip-kahop = holath-quenmir

## Formula sandbox tuning

User-supplied formulas in Gridmoor execute inside a restricted interpreter with hard ceilings on time, memory, and call depth. Reviewers should confirm any change to these ceilings is justified in the PR description, since raising them widens the abuse surface. Defaults were chosen from production traces. The current limits are as follows.

limits module of tafog-fawip:
WEIGHTS = {
    "julix": 57,
    "lamys": 992,
    "kasvan": 209,
    "quenok": 750,
    "alddor": 259,
    "oliath": 1009,
    "wenix": 815,
}

The Grainbridge CSV import wizard runs as a standalone service behind the gateway and never touches production tables directly; parsed rows land in a quarantine schema until an operator approves promotion. Uploaded files are size-capped, content-type checked, and scanned before parsing, and all temp files are written to an encrypted scratch volume that is wiped on restart. Formula-injection sanitization is enabled by default and should not be disabled without sign-off. For review, the deployment ships with the following configuration values.

config for tajof-tajef:
ralael:
  pin: 3468
  metrics_host: metrics.ralael.lumicsys.internal
  tenant: casath
  seal: seal_c325d9c6

## Search Relevance Tuning — Support Notes

Relevance weights for the Quillbrook catalog search live in the `relevance_profiles` table, not in config files. Support can adjust boost factors per merchant after approval from the search guild. Changes take effect on the next indexer pass (every 15 min). Do not edit synonym maps directly; file a request instead. To inspect current profiles, query the tuning replica read-only. Use the following connection string for that replica.

warehouse DSN: clickhouse://druys_svc:Pl@db-47e1.orvexstack.corp:5432/beldor